Abstract

Rapid population growth, limited developable land, and rising housing demand create increasing pressure on the urban settlement system in Balikpapan. This study aims to develop a comprehensive model to support sustainable housing planning by examining the interactions among social, economic, and environmental factors.  The study gave strategic optimization in housing and setllement planing in Balikpapan with social, economic, and environmental consideration. A system dynamics model was constructed using causal loop and stock–flow structures to simulate system behavior from 2020 to 2050. Indicator performance was assessed using an entropy-based weighting method, while efficiency was evaluated through a data envelopment analysis approach. Three policy scenarios were tested: economic growth, development of public rental housing, and a combined strategy. The results of the study indicate that the environmental output variable (green open space) experienced a significant decline from 696,800 hectares to 390,599.6 hectares. The results also show that environmental indicators consistently achieved the highest performance, followed by social indicators, while economic indicators remained the weakest due to high development costs. Therefore, recommendations for improvements in the environmental sector can provide better output results. The scenario focused on vertical public housing provides the most balanced outcome, improving social welfare while reducing pressure on land resources. These findings emphasize the importance of integrated policy planning that aligns effectiveness and resource efficiency to support sustainable urban development.
